Voices Across Time take Christmas show online

23/12/2020

Local theatre group find a way to bring their popular Christmas show to families in their own homes

Voices Across Time, the popular Local theatre group, will be bringing their Christmas show direct to you at your place this evening.   But Once A Year will be streamed at 6pm.

The Voices Across Time team combine music and history in their original shows.  Normally at this time of year they would be touring local care homes to bring festive joy to the residents.   Public performances with live audiences would also form an integral part of their pre-Christmas schedule.      This year, the pandemic has stopped all of that, but Voices Across Time have worked to ensure the show still goes on.

Their latest production is called But Once A Year.   Joe Cummings from Voices Across Time said: “The show is the story of Christmas journeying from the birth of Christ through to modern day.   It looks at communities and family Christmases and different traditions that happen over time.

“Because people are celebrating such different Christmases, particularly this year in 2020, we’re looking at the best bits and worst bits of previous Christmases.”

The show has been filmed in St Mary’s Church in Adderbury and will be streamed this evening.   As the pandemic took hold the group realised the needed to find alternative ways to continue performing.

Flo Taylor said: “We rose to the challenge.   We produced a radio podcast with Radio Horton and then realised whilst we couldn’t do a live show, under COVID restrictions we could still film it.

“We bubbled together and pulled our cast to live together.”

Jo added: “We filmed in St Mary’s Church in Adderbury.   It gave us a really good opportunity to use parts of the church that wouldn’t normally be available to use during a show.   We filmed in corners with some amazing carvings and strange historic artefacts”.

Voices Across Time have maintained their links with local care homes during the last few months, utilising Zoom to run fun sessions stimulating movement and generating conversations.   Care home residents have been watching But Once A Year in a shared experience with their families further afield.
